Signs of a Bad Battery

A bad battery gives you warning signs. If you notice any of these, it’s time to replace it:

  • Battery drains fast – Even when you don’t use your phone much.
  • Overheating – Your phone gets hot even with simple tasks.
  • Slow charging – It takes forever to reach 100%.
  • Swollen shape – Your battery looks bloated or pushes against the back cover.
  • Phone shuts down randomly – Even when it shows battery life left.

If you see these signs, don’t wait. A failing battery can damage your phone or even cause a fire.

Fake vs. Real Batteries

Fake batteries are a huge problem. They look real but fail quickly. Even worse, they can explode or catch fire. How do you tell the difference?

  • Price too low – If the deal is too good, it’s fake.
  • No brand name – Real batteries come with clear labels.
  • Poor packaging – Look for spelling mistakes and cheap wrapping.
  • No safety markings – Genuine batteries meet safety rules and have marks to prove it.
  • Short life – A fake battery won’t hold a charge for long.

To stay safe, buy from trusted stores or the phone brand itself. Avoid cheap online deals.

FAQs – Must-Know Facts

  1. How do I make my battery last longer?
  • Keep your phone out of heat.
  • Don’t let the battery drain to 0% often.
  • Use original chargers.
  • Avoid using the phone while charging.
  1. Can a bad battery damage my phone?

Yes. A faulty battery can overheat and harm internal parts. It can also swell and break the phone casing.

  1. Why does my phone battery drain fast overnight?

Apps running in the background drain power. Check your settings and close unneeded apps.

  1. Are third-party batteries safe?

Some are, some aren’t. If you buy from a trusted company, they can work well. But cheap knockoffs are risky.

  1. Can I replace my phone battery myself?

Some phones allow it. Others have sealed cases. If unsure, let a pro do it.
